Hi all,

I am having a problem with beat mapping. I am trying to map slow,  
simple, rubato piano performances. I have a piece at about 40bpm -  
all 1/4 notes. The beat mapping starts out ok, but 2 bars in I keep  
getting the warning that a tempo that is too low will result when I  
drag the beat marker to the note. I get the same results when I use  
the "beats from region" feature. Help!


Lee

Re: [Logic_Cafe] beat mapping

2007-10-04 by GAmoore@aol.com

40 is pretty slow. Why don't you make them half notes rather than quarter 
notes, and put the tempo to 80.

This has come up before. Try beat mapping with half notes at twice  
the tempo. Logic doesn't like to dip below 40 bpm, for some reason.
